The strategic objectives developed by Beykoz University for effective and efficient water management are as follows:
1. To act in collaboration and develop partnerships with university administration, students, academic and administrative staff, non-governmental organizations, representatives of the business world, and all segments of society in line with international and national policies and objectives related to effective and efficient water management.
2. To increase the number of scientific publications and projects related to water and water efficiency.
3. To use equipment such as low-flow faucets, water-saving toilet systems, and smart irrigation systems in buildings.
4. To encourage awareness and social responsibility activities of student clubs regarding water efficiency and water conservation.
5. To organize in-service training for academic and administrative staff on water conservation.
6. To conduct activities to raise public awareness on issues such as water efficiency, water conservation, and drought.
7. To promote xeriscaping practices and use efficient irrigation techniques.
8. To increase the proportion of green spaces irrigated with natural spring water.
9. To reduce per capita water consumption.
10. To implement environmentally friendly methods for recycling, storing, and preserving oils.
11. Composting to improve the water retention properties of soil in on-campus green spaces.
12. To water the campus green spaces during times when evaporation is least.
13. To identify and quickly fixing leaks in faucets and sinks, minimizing water loss and leaks.
